A share in a partnership

  1. can be transferred in accordance with the terms and conditions contained in the partnership deed

  2. can be transferred only if all the partners agree for such transfer

  3. cannot be transferred at all

  4. can be transferred through the recognized stock exchanges

Reveal answer Fill a bubble to check yourself
B Correct answer
Explanation

A partnership share cannot be transferred without unanimous consent of all partners because partnership is based on mutual confidence and personal relationships. Unlike company shares, partnership interests are not freely transferable. The transfer requires all partners' agreement as it fundamentally changes the partnership composition.
